The overview below groups typical Business Renovation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in your area.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- typical costs for routine repairs like patching walls or fixing fixtures generally range from $250 to $600. Many local contractors handle these smaller jobs within this range, though prices can vary based on scope and location.
Major Renovations - larger projects such as kitchen or bathroom upgrades often fall between $5,000 and $15,000. These are common for mid-sized renovations, with some projects reaching higher depending on materials and complexity.
Full Property Makeovers - comprehensive renovations involving multiple rooms or extensive work can range from $20,000 to $100,000+. While many projects stay within the middle of this spectrum, larger, more complex projects can exceed this range.
Design and Planning Services - costs for professional design or consultation services typically start around $1,000 and can go up to $10,000+ for detailed planning. These fees vary based on project size and the level of customization needed.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

When comparing local contractors for business renovation projects, it’s important to consider their experience with similar types of work. A contractor who has successfully completed projects comparable in scope and complexity can often bring valuable insights and practical solutions. Reviewing their portfolio or asking about past work can help determine if their expertise aligns with the specific needs of the renovation. Selecting a service provider with relevant experience can contribute to a smoother process and a more successful outcome.
Clear, written expectations are essential when evaluating potential service providers. This includes detailed descriptions of the scope of work, deliverables, and any specific requirements for the project. Having these details documented helps ensure everyone is on the same page and reduces the likelihood of misunderstandings. When discussing options with local contractors, it’s beneficial to ask how they communicate project details and confirm that expectations are clearly outlined before work begins.
Reputable references and strong communication are key factors in choosing a reliable business renovation contractor. Asking for references from previous clients can provide insights into the contractor’s reliability, professionalism, and quality of work. Additionally, good communication throughout the process-such as responsiveness and clarity-can make a significant difference in how smoothly the project progresses.
